24 Elf Mischief Ideas (and What You Need!) to Get Busy Mums & Dads Through December

The elves are back — and if you're anything like most parents, December becomes a whirlwind of school plays, Christmas prep, and trying desperately to remember to move that elf before bed! So to take the pressure off, we’ve rounded up 24 easy, hilarious, and fun Elf ideas, complete with the items you’ll need for each.

Whether you're a “set it up in 30 seconds” parent or a lover of full-blown elf theatre, there’s something here for every household.

1. Elf Arrival in a Tangle of Christmas Lights


What you need: A string of fairy lights


A super simple arrival idea! Wrap your elf in sparkling lights with a note:


“Your house needs to be more Christmassy! 24 sleeps!”

2. Cheeky Cheerios


What you need: Cheerios, tape


Stick a Cheerio on your elf’s bum and spell out “BUM HOLES” with cereal.


Guaranteed giggles!

3. Elf on the Slopes


What you need: Cotton wool balls or sheets, candy canes (for a sledge), or tin foil


Create a snowy scene on stairs, banisters, or any surface.

4. Minty Oreos


What you need: Oreos, mint toothpaste


Your cheeky elf is swapping the filling for toothpaste. Classic elf chaos.

5. “I’M AN ELF… GET ME OUT OF HERE!”


What you need: Tape, plate/board, sprinkles, jelly snakes, anything gross


Tape your elf to a board surrounded by creepy crawlies and treats.

6. Crisp Making


What you need: Potatoes, pen, slicer, crisps


Draw faces on potatoes, slice one, and lay out “fresh crisps” on the other side.

7. North Pole Museum of POO


What you need: Cupcake cases, sweets, labels


Create piles of “poo” using different sweets: reindeer, elf, penguin, unicorn, yeti, Santa, nutcracker — anything goes!

8. Elves Eating Domino’s


What you need: Domino pieces


Lay them out like a pizza for a funny “treat night.”


9. Chillin’ with Egg Sheeran


What you need: Egg, orange wool or pen, printed album covers & guitar


Create a tiny Ed Sheeran-inspired egg star and chill him in the fridge.

10. Baker Elf – Rainbow Cake


What you need:

  • 3 eggs

  • Butter, caster sugar, self-raising flour (equal weight to eggs)

  • Food colouring

  • Sprinkles


Set up ingredients with a note explaining how to make Elf Rainbow Cake.

11. Nerf Fight


What you need: Nerf guns, bullets, toys/teddies


Set up a full toy battle scene!

12. Elf Joke of the Day


What you need: A plate, a cracked egg & a note


Draw a face on your egg & tell this classic:


🤣 “What happens when you tell an egg a joke? It cracks up!”

13. Elves Feed the Pets


What you need: Pet food, toy vehicles, scoops


Let the elves “help” by feeding the pets… messily.

14. Elf Makes Breakfast


What you need: Clingfilm, cereal, spoon


Cover the toilet bowl with clingfilm, add cereal, and leave a note:


🥣 “I made breakfast in a BIG bowl!”

15. Snow Art


What you need: Artificial snow cans


Have the elf spray a little festive art on windows or mirrors (easy to clean!).

16. Be Good Reminder


What you need: A lump of coal


Leave a note:💔 “It upsets me when you’re not good…”

17. Moana (or Any) Party Scene


What you need: Toys, themed items


Set up a mini movie scene with a quote from the film.

18. Phases of the Moon


What you need: Printed moon chart


Cut out the full moon and place it around your elf’s bum.


Silly and adorable!

19. Elf Choir


What you need: Empty cans, googly eyes, straws/sticks


Create singing cans and position your elf as the conductor.


🎶 “Jingle Bells, Jingle Bells, Daddy Smells!”

20. Smartie Pants


What you need: Pants, Smarties


Scatter Smarties over pants and leave a note:


🩲 “Good morning, Smartie Pants!”

21. Elf Makes a Mess


What you need: Cooked spaghetti, sweets, syrup, sprinkles


A messy sensory explosion in the kitchen.

22. Crime Scene Elf


What you need: Flour, googly eyes


Spread flour, leave an elf-shaped silhouette, add eyes and a note.

23. Elf vs Hoover


What you need: Hoover, slime ingredients


Elf gets “stuck” mid-clean whilst preparing slime for the kids.

24. Scavenger Hunt


What you need: Printed rhyming clues, hiding spots, giant chocolate coin


Finish the season with a magical treasure hunt.
